Transaction 8c28e89caf498ea03bbd564e12b768da3248894ed35aa170c0a36164619dabe4
1 Input
1 Output
-
8c28e89caf498ea03bbd564e12b768da3248894ed35aa170c0a36164619dabe4:0
- value
- 380520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 900d35365090e7055cbd32827836e16a18bd2180 OP_EQUAL
- address
- 3Eph3s9vMd3DjNEPkZrn4xrbYqP2hgpJfo